Tatarstan President will meet with divers, record-breakers
13 March 2014, Thursday
On March 14 Tatarstan President Rustam Minnikhanov will meet with members of diving research team of All-Russia public organisation “Russian Geographical Society” in Tatarstan, participants of a record project “Cold pole”. Tatarstan divers set two world records, they explored two lakes, Labynkyr and Vorota in Oymyakon (Yakutiya).
The purpose of diving was exploration of lakes, testing organism and equipment in extreme conditions, as well as collection of bottom and water samples. The collected samples were given to biologists. Scientists from the Institute of biological problems of cryolithic zone of Siberian department of Russian Academy of Sciences also walked with Tatarstan divers. The divers took the flag of the Kazan Kremlin with them under water.
Tomorrow participants of the expedition will come back to Kazan to meet with Tatarstan President Rustam Minnikhanov at 10:30 a.m. They will tell about details of the unique project.
